skyndir
skyndir, m. = skundi; þat er meiriskyndir langrar rœðu Kgs. 9624; beraskyndi at um e-t dvs. haste, ile med noget: konungr bar skyndi at um ferð sína,þvíat sjalfr vildi hann heldr bera njósnen aðrir fyrir honum Fm. VIII, 5720;bjósk hann því af skyndi miklum okhafði önga brynju, en hafði hann önnurvápn Sturl. II, 195 &vl 2.

Part of speech: m
